City of Hardin County, Kentucky Profile

Hardin County was established by the first Legislature in 1792. It was named for Colonel John Hardin, an officer in the Continental Army. The county, when formed, contained 7000 square miles. All or part of the following counties were formed of territory which originally was contained in Hardin County: Breckinridge, Grayson, Green, Ohio, Meade, LaRue, Daviess, Hancock, Henderson, McLean, Hart, Edmonson, and Butler. Cities within Hardin County include: Elizabethtown, Radcliff, Fort Knox, Vine Grove, West Point, Upton and Sonora.

Hardin County is one of 120 counties in Kentucky. The county is in the Elizabethtown metro area. The estimated population in 2004 was 96,066.

Hardin County Public Schools:
Elementary School: Creekside, G. C. Burkhead, Howevalley, Lakewood, Lincoln Trail, Meadow View, New Highland, Parkway, Rineyville, Vine Grove and Woodland Elementary Schools.

Middle School: Bluegrass, East Hardin, James T. Alton, Radcliff and West Hardin Middle Schools

High School: Central Hardin, John Hardin, North Hardin, Brown Street, Day Treatment and Lincoln Village High Schools
